BENDING METHOD AND APPARATUS FOR THE SAME

A first-face forming portion of a workpiece and a second-face forming portion spaced apart from it by the length of an intermediate portion are clamped with a first-face forming die and a second-face forming die, respectively. The first-face forming die is moved either upward or downward and the second-face forming die is moved in a direction toward the first-face forming die, and the second-face forming die is pressed against the first-face forming die to shape the upright wall portion.

HEMMING APPARATUS
20190134693 · 2019-05-09 ·

A hem punch is floating-supported to a slide cam by a floating-support mechanism. After the hem punch is moved to be positioned at a pre-hemming start position by a driver cam, preliminary hemming is performed. Subsequently, the hem punch is moved to be positioned at a final-hemming start position by the driver cam, and then the hem punch is moved downward by the floating-support mechanism to perform final hemming.

Cam type press

Provided is a cam type press capable of controlling deformation of a flange of a panel in the course of processing the flange, thus reducing deformation such as a crease, or the like, of the flange. The cam type press includes a padding cam installed to be movable in a slope direction. A slider is installed to be movable toward the padding cam, with a process gap into which a portion of a panel is inserted to form a flange between one side of the padding cam and one side of the slider. An adjustment block adjusts the process gap provided between the other side of the padding cam and the other side of the slider.

V-DRIVE AND SLIDE ELEMENT FOR THE SAME
20180272409 · 2018-09-27 ·

A slide element for a wedge drive, with a slide element receptacle and a drive element between which the slide element is to be placed. In order to achieve a high wear resistance and a simple design, it is proposed for the slide element to have a head rail, which is detachably fastened to the slide element and, as part of the dovetail-shaped side of the slide element, forms the second sliding surfaces on the dovetail-shaped section, by means of which forces are transmitted during the return stroke during which the slide element receptacle is moved away from the drive element.

Press forming apparatus

Disclosed is a press forming apparatus including a lower die assembly having a lower die, an upper die assembly having an upper die configured to be movable in a first direction relative to the lower die, a cam slider configured to be movable in a second direction relative to the lower die, and a conversion mechanism configured to convert a movement of the upper die assembly in the first direction into a movement of the cam slider in the second direction.

Slider arrangement
12434451 · 2025-10-07 · ·

A slider arrangement (1) has a wedge drive tool with a slider upper portion (10) and a slider lower portion (20) which, due to a relative movement with respect to the slider upper portion (10), can be displaced along guides (30) from an initial position into a working position and vice versa. At least one return device (40) is provided in order to bring about the initial position of the slider upper portion (10) and slider lower portion (20), wherein the return device (40) has a screw plug (50) at the end in order to attach the return device (40) in a recess (11) of the slider arrangement (1). The screw plug (50) can have one or at least two rotation prevention part(s) (51) designed to prevent a rotation of the screw plug (50) beyond a maximum acceptable rotation angle .
